Folding@home is a massively distributed protein folding project.
Protein folding is an analysis tool for molecular biology.

We know from reading the DNA which amino acids make up any given
protein, but we don't know what shape the protein folds into, so we
don't know what its chemical properties are, until we've run a protein
folding program on that molecule.

Folding@home is currently folding several proteins, including one that
is believed to be responsible for Alzheimer's disease.
